KR Media appointed media partner for the East Africa Trade Forum

The Kampala-based consultancy will run accreditation, the press room and the daily bulletin for the three-day forum in November.

KAMPALA, 11 September — KR Media Limited has been appointed media partner for the East Africa Trade Forum, taking responsibility for the accreditation of regional press, the operation of the forum press room and the production of a daily bulletin distributed to 42 outlets across the region.

The appointment follows a competitive process run by the forum secretariat in August. KR Media will field a team of eleven, including four editors drawn from theKampalaReport.com, the company's own newsroom.

"A forum is judged by what gets reported out of it," said Alex Bagenzire Atuhaire, Executive Editor at KR Media Limited. "Our job is to make sure a journalist arriving on day one can file by lunchtime — accredited, briefed and with the numbers in hand."

The forum runs from 18 to 20 November at the Kampala Serena Conference Centre and is expected to draw delegations from six countries. Accreditation opens on 1 October and closes on 7 November.
